The Oyster Legacy: A Foundation of Durability and Precision

The name "Oyster" itself speaks volumes about the watch's inherent robustness. Introduced by Rolex in 1926, the Oyster case revolutionized watchmaking by offering unprecedented water resistance. This groundbreaking design, characterized by its hermetically sealed construction, forms the bedrock of the 31 mm steel and yellow gold model. The Oyster case, meticulously crafted from Oystersteel and 18-karat yellow gold, ensures exceptional protection for the delicate inner workings of the watch. The seamless integration of these two materials – the robust strength of Oystersteel and the luxurious warmth of yellow gold – is a hallmark of Rolex's masterful craftsmanship.

The case's construction, described as a "monobloc middle case," signifies a single-piece middle case formed from a solid block of metal. This eliminates weak points and contributes significantly to the watch's water resistance and overall durability. The screw-down crown, another key element of the Oyster architecture, further enhances water resistance and protects the movement from dust and moisture. This meticulous attention to detail extends to every component of the case, creating a timepiece designed to withstand the rigors of daily life while maintaining its exquisite appearance.

Materials: A Symphony of Steel, Gold, and Diamonds

The combination of Oystersteel and 18-karat yellow gold elevates the watch beyond mere functionality. Oystersteel, a proprietary alloy developed by Rolex, is renowned for its exceptional strength, corrosion resistance, and lustrous finish. Its resilience ensures the longevity of the watch, while its subtly brushed finish provides a sophisticated contrast to the gleaming yellow gold. The 18-karat yellow gold, a symbol of luxury and prestige, adds a touch of opulence, subtly enhancing the watch's overall aesthetic appeal.
